A leading real estate firm in Leeds seeks a dedicated Mortgage Administrator. This full-time position at the Head Office requires excellent organizational skills and attention to detail.
Responsibilities include:
- Checking documentation
- Liaising with lenders and customers
- Providing updates throughout the mortgage application process
The role offers uncapped commission, comprehensive training, and numerous benefits. Ideal candidates will have strong communication skills and experience in administration.

How to prepare for a job interview at Manning Stainton
β¨Know Your Stuff
Make sure you understand the mortgage application process inside out. Brush up on key terms and common documentation requirements. This will help you answer questions confidently and show that you're serious about the role.
β¨Show Off Your Organisational Skills
Since the job requires excellent organisational skills, prepare examples from your past experiences where you've successfully managed multiple tasks or projects. Be ready to discuss how you prioritise and keep track of details.
β¨Practice Your Communication
As a Mortgage Support Specialist, you'll need to liaise with both lenders and customers. Practise explaining complex information in simple terms. You might even want to role-play some scenarios with a friend to get comfortable.
β¨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, donβt forget to ask questions! Inquire about the team dynamics, training opportunities, or what success looks like in this role. This shows your interest and hel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.
